This vintage vehicle is a 1966 Fiat 500F, originally registered in Rome, Italy. Manufactured in the era of classic Italian automotive charm, this well-preserved compact car features a distinctive 650cc inline twin engine sourced from a Fiat 126, along with a coil-spring rear suspension for added stability and charm. Sporting a vibrant red paintjob and white vinyl interior retrim completed in 2011, it also boasts a replacement folding canvas roof panel and an Abarth-style engine cover, adding to its unique character.
